+------------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 FUNCTION DESCRIPTION
+
+Compute LSF weighting factors
+
+ d[i] = lsf[i+1] - lsf[i-1]
+
+ The weighting factors are approximated by two line segment
+
+ First segment passes by the following 2 points:
+
+ d[i] = 0Hz wf[i] = 3.347
+ d[i] = 450Hz wf[i] = 1.8
+
+ Second segment passes by the following 2 points:
+
+ d[i] = 450Hz wf[i] = 1.8
+ d[i] = 1500Hz wf[i] = 1.0
+
+ if( d[i] < 450Hz )
+ wf[i] = 3.347 - ( (3.347-1.8) / (450-0)) * d[i]
+ else
+ wf[i] = 1.8 - ( (1.8-1.0) / (1500-450)) * (d[i] - 450)
+
+
+ if( d[i] < 1843)
+ wf[i] = 3427 - (28160*d[i])>>15
+ else
+ wf[i] = 1843 - (6242*(d[i]-1843))>>15

+/*----------------------------------------------------------------------------
+; FUNCTION CODE
+----------------------------------------------------------------------------*/
+
+void Lsf_wt(
+ Word16 *lsf, /* input : LSF vector */
+ Word16 *wf, /* output: square of weighting factors */
+ Flag *pOverflow
+)
+{
+ Word16 temp;
+ Word16 wgt_fct;
+ Word16 i;
+ Word16 *p_wf = wf;
+ Word16 *p_lsf = &lsf[0];
+ Word16 *p_lsf_2 = &lsf[1];
+
+ OSCL_UNUSED_ARG(pOverflow);
+
+ /* wf[0] = lsf[1] - 0 */
+ *(p_wf++) = *(p_lsf_2++);
+
+ for (i = 4; i != 0 ; i--)
+ {
+ *(p_wf++) = *(p_lsf_2++) - *(p_lsf++);
+ *(p_wf++) = *(p_lsf_2++) - *(p_lsf++);
+ }
+ /*
+ * wf[9] = 4000 - lsf[8]
+ */
+ *(p_wf) = 16384 - *(p_lsf);
+
+ p_wf = wf;
+
+ for (i = 10; i != 0; i--)
+ {
+ /*
+ * (wf[i] - 450);
+ * 1843 == 450 Hz (Q15 considering 7FFF = 8000 Hz)
+ */
+ wgt_fct = *p_wf;
+ temp = wgt_fct - 1843;
+
+ if (temp > 0)
+ {
+ temp = (Word16)(((Word32)temp * 6242) >> 15);
+ wgt_fct = 1843 - temp;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 temp = (Word16)(((Word32)wgt_fct * 28160) >> 15);
+ wgt_fct = 3427 - temp;
+ }
+
+ *(p_wf++) = wgt_fct << 3;
+
+ } /* for (i = 10; i != 0; i--) */
+
+ return;
+
+} /* Lsf_wt() */
